Metlock Electronics manufactures two HD television models: the Royale, which sells for $1,204, and a new model, the Majestic, which sells for $946. The production costs calculated per unit under traditional costing for each model in 2022 were as follows: Traditional Costing Royale Majestic Direct materials $516 $274 Direct labour ($20 per hour) 100 80 Manufacturing overhead ($35 per direct labour hour) 175 140 Total per unit cost $791 $494 In 2022, Metlock manufactured 17,200 units of the Royale and 8,600 units of the Majestic. The overhead rate of $35 per direct labour hour was determined by dividing total estimated manufacturing overhead of $4.2 million by the total direct labour hours (120,400) for the two models. Under traditional costing, the gross profit on the models was $413 for the Royale or ($1,204 - $791), and $452 for the Majestic or ($946 - $494). Because of this difference, management is considering phasing out the Royale model and increasing the production of the Majestic model. Before finalizing its decision, management asks Metlock's controller to prepare an analysis using activity-based costing (ABC). The controller accumulates the following information about overhead for the year ended December 31, 2022: Estimated Overhead Estimated Use of Cost Drivers Activity-Based Overhead Rate Activity Cost Pools Cost Drivers Purchasing Number of orders $645,000 21,500 $30 per order Machine set-ups Number of set-ups 516,000 17,200 $30 per set-up Machining Machine hours 2,666,000 86,000 $31 per hour Quality control Number of inspections 387,000 4,300 $90 per inspection The cost drivers used for each product were as follows: Cost Drivers Royale Majestic Total Purchase orders 9,675 11,825 21,500 Machine set-ups 8,600 8,600 17,200 Machine hours 34,400 51,600 86,000 Inspections 1,935 2,365 4,300 Assign the total 2022 manufacturing overhead costs to the two products using activity-based costing (ABC). (Round answers to 2 decimal places, e.g. 15.25.) Royale Majestic Per unit overhead cost $ 104 $ 282 eTextbook and Media Attempts: unlimited What was the cost per unit and gross profit of each model using ABC costing?
